A lot of the websites we create for clients we put on a Content Management 
System.  We are now starting to use Environment Deployment with Beanstalk 
however we are running into an issue with keeping repos up to date with client 
material.

Before we used deployments we would just clone the repository on the production 
server.  When we would need to make changes we would commit from the production 
server to get the latest changes.  Generally these include images since 
everything else is database side.

Well the problem we have now is there is now way to sync back up to the 
production repository since deployments simply copy the files onto the server.

Is there a way we can continue to use deployments but get around this issues 
with CMS'?  

Only thing I can think of is creating a script that would basically rsync the 
files onto the developers local machine and then can commit them into the 
production repo but rsync scares me when I'm not there to watch it.
